What skills and experience we're looking for
We are looking for an experienced and effective Upper Key Stage Two teacher to join our team. You will be someone who has high expectations, a strong understanding of the curriculum, and a proven track record of securing excellent outcomes for pupils. You will bring energy, creativity and a commitment to inclusive, child-centred practice. As a valued member of our teaching team, you will inspire a love of learning in your pupils and work collaboratively with colleagues to drive continual improvement across the phase and school.
This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to make a positive impact in a supportive and ambitious school environment.
We are seeking a teacher who:
- Has substantial experience teaching in UKS2
- Is confident in teaching the full range of the UKS2 curriculum, including preparing pupils for end-of-key-stage assessments
- Is committed to inclusive practice and meeting the needs of all learners
- Demonstrates excellent subject knowledge, planning, and classroom management
- Uses assessment effectively to inform teaching and raise standards
- Works well as part of a team and contributes positively to school life
- Is reflective, enthusiastic, and keen to continue their own professional development
- Brings a warm, caring and positive approach to supporting children’s wellbeing and progress

Windmill L.E.A.D. Academy is a vibrant and inclusive primary school located in Sneinton, Nottingham. We are proud of our richly diverse community - over 40 languages are spoken in our school, making it a true celebration of cultures, perspectives, and global learning.
Our pupils are curious, compassionate, and eager to learn, supported by families who deeply value education. We deliver a well-structured and engaging curriculum that is both relevant and inspiring, carefully designed to reflect the needs and interests of our children.
At Windmill, conduct and behaviour is underpinned by the principles of the UN Convention on the Rights of the Child, and our comprehensive mental health and well-being curriculum ensures our pupils have the emotional tools they need to thrive in today’s world.
Enrichment is a key part of life at Windmill. We create meaningful opportunities for children, parents, and the wider community to come together and celebrate learning and culture - whether it's through curriculum-linked projects, community events, or joyful experiences like our annual Holi Colour Throw.
Visitors frequently remark on our welcoming atmosphere, where warmth, respect, and a strong sense of community are evident throughout the school. We are proud of our collaborative and dedicated staff team, who work closely together to put children at the heart of everything we do.
We are committed to ensuring every child achieves their full potential and enjoys a broad, enriched curriculum that prepares them not only for academic success but for life beyond the classroom.
